Nicki Minaj is to star in her own reality TV show.

The 'Starships' hitmaker – who was recently unveiled as a judge on 'American Idol' – is said to have begun filming a fly-on-the-wall documentary series for the E! network earlier this week, gossip blogger Perez Hilton has revealed.

Insiders are convinced the eccentric singer will make for great viewing.

One told the Daily Mirror newspaper: "Nicki's life on camera will blow away all other previous reality stars."

Nicki recently revealed she agreed to judge 'American Idol' because it is such a "credible" show.

She said: "This is such a credible brand. It's really serious, it's real deal it's not anything else other than really looking for talent. If I can be a part of that I'm really down for it."

Nicki says she has always been a fan of the programme - which is now entering its 12th season - and remembers when Jordin Sparks won the sixth series.

She said: "I remember watching 'American Idol' in the first season and feeling inspired.

"I spoke to Jordin Sparks the other day and here she is starring in a movie ['Sparkle'] and I said to her, 'I remember watching you and picking up my phone.' "

"I didn't vote for her because my brother liked the other guy, but I told her that, 'You know you're a part of history, kind of. Because I remember calling and seeing your face and being inspired and hearing your story.' "
